Tiger Airways expands fleet and flights

Budget carrier Tiger Airways said it is to add six Airbus A320 aircraft to its fleet by March next year as part of moves to step up operations and capture the growing appetite for low-fare travel in the Asia-Pacific region. Tiger Airways could stay grounded throughout July

Low-cost carrier Tiger Airways Australia has accepted that it could stay grounded throughout July as Australian safety inspectors continue to probe its operations. The grounding, which is costing the Singapore-based airline $1.6 million a week, claimed its first casualty with the announced departure of CEO Crawford Rix.
